Mumbai rains: Heavy showers lash parts of city; traffic disrupted, roads waterlogged, airlines issue advisories
NEW DELHI: Mumbai woke up to heavy overnight showers on Sunday, with the IMD Colaba observatory recording 120.8 mm of rainfall in the 24 hours ending 8.30 am.
In comparison, the Santacruz observatory recorded 83.8 mm during the same period.
Waterlogging has been reported in several parts of the city, including the Andheri subway, where traffic has been diverted.
Airlines have issued advisories to passengers travelling to Mumbai airport
SpiceJet tweeted, “Due to bad weather (rain) in Mumbai (BOM), traffic congestion is expected. Passengers travelling to the airport are requested to keep a tab on live traffic and flight status, and plan their journey accordingly. http://spicejet.com/#status”
IndiGo also issued a travel advisory, “The showers have not taken a break in #Mumbai, and neither has the road congestion. Traffic towards the airport is currently slower in several areas. We recommend planning your commute in advance and checking your flight status before heading out. Our airport teams are on the ground and ready to support you as you travel. Thank you for your patience and cooperation.”
The rain is expected to intensify later in the day, likely causing further waterlogging, traffic snarls, and disruptions to local train services.
